Thowthoni is a Rural village located in Kadam, Lakhimpur, Assam.
The total population of Thowthoni is 1,186.
Thowthoni village comprises 243 households.
The literacy rate in Thowthoni is 90%. Among the literate population of 923, there are 494 literate males and 429 literate females.
In Thowthoni, there are 587 males and 599 females, with a sex ratio of 1020 females per 1000 males.
There are 160 children (13.5% of population), comprising 65 boys and 95 girls.
The total number of workers in Thowthoni is 723, with 716 main workers and 7 marginal workers.
In Thowthoni, there are 1 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 1 females) and 234 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(118 males, 116 females).
Thowthoni is located in Assam state, Lakhimpur district, and falls under Kadam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 287998 and LGD code is 287998.
